I remember seeing him back in 2007 at the Warehouse in Calgary (the best god damn club there ever was in this city, until it got shut down), before he really got big. Then again in 2009 at Flames Central, and probably will see him on both the 6th and the 7th because I have two separate groups of friends going to each one. Deadmau5 live is pretty worth it because generally the visuals/lights are sweet and he has a really sick live setup. Monome 256, Lemur, Korg everythings, Xone 4D, Mac Book Pro's running Ableton, etc. His massive digital interface really allows for anything to happen. Back at Flames Central, the giant nerd finished the night with Keyboard cat. What the fuck lol.

His older productions were better, the stuff he's churning out now is old and stale. "Some Chords" is actually a pretty terrible track, it's the same three chords over and over again.
